Abstract:

Newly revised and updated, this is the essential guide to state-of-the-art digital storytelling for audiences, creators, and teachers.


• Documents how digital storytelling has become an international movement, with vibrant communities of practice, ever-developing ideas, and growing appeal

• Captures the full depth and breadth of the history and present of digital storytelling, while also offering practical tips for getting started making stories

• Incorporates a plethora of digital technologies, from video to augmented reality, and mobile devices to virtual reality

• Points out that digital storytelling has a variety of uses and encompasses a growing diversity of technologies, even as it becomes ever more accessible to everyday creators
